What is two-factor authentication – also known as 2FA?
2FA is a method of confirming a user's claimed identity by utilizing something they know such as a password and a second factor other. An example of a second step is the user repeating back something that was sent to them through an out-of-band mechanism. Or, the second step might be a six-digit number generated by an app that is common to the user and the authentication system.
